Working is freelance isn’t for everyone. It comes with it’s own pressures and often freelancers don’t realise they don’t like it until they’ve been doing it a while. So to avoid some tears and potential mistakes, here’s some of the disadvantages.
- Isolation. No water cooler, no work mates, no after work drinks.
- You, not the accounts department, deal with the tax man directly.
- Irregular work flow. You’re constantly looking for work.
- Irregular income. A consequence of above.
- No employment benefits or holiday pay.
- The boundaries between home and work are lost.
- Being your own boss, and accounts dept, marketing dept, sales dept and general dogsbody.
- Distractions. The kids, YouTube, Sunday afternoon football.
